Inside the folder, create a new file called robot.animation_controllers.json. In order to customize a toolbar, click the three dots on the right side of the last tool on the bar (use "Customize" to add more tools and "Reset" to get the default set-up back). Along with parenting, setting the pivot points correctly is the most important part of creating the bone structure. The Graph Editor View allows you to adjust animation curves in a selected channel. In the following section, we'll take a look at how to add an animation to your entity, how to create your own animation in Blockbench, and finally, how to use animation controllers. Lag when breaking custom block model : r/MCreator They are represented by diamond shapes (for linear interpolation) and circles (for smooth interpolation) on the Timeline Track. Depending on the modeling style, it can make sense to completely stick to the grid or only move the cubes in half or quarter increments. And use the same name as your file name for your model. Select the rotate tool and rotate the whole robot to the left slightly. The Z-buffer is a technology of managing the image depth coordinates in 3D graphics, which helps distinguish objects that are rendered from those hidden behind them. When you're creating bones for moving parts of the model, always think about which point the part should rotate around. Default keybindings can also be changed there. The UV Editor also comes with four sliders, two for position and two for scale. You can now start to work on the texture. Now we move on to the last section for this guide the "rotation", "translation", and "scale" settings keep in mind the "pose angle" is not used in your display settings and is just used for seeing how the angle of the pose looks at other degrees. Introducing the Minecraft Entity Wizard plugin for Blockbench! The interface modes offer a variety of tools for the different parts of the creation process. You can use it to test, for example,f800f8 blank texture and 000000 blank texture (These are color codes, click the frame cube icon to add a blank texture) (also these are the colors of a missing texture). The fix for this is just to add a sub bone or folder to the main folder. Blockbench puts all the tools at your disposal to make the creation process of low-poly models as easy as possible. To prevent this, we can use the option blend_transition, which allows us to smoothly transition out of the animation in a set time. On right click they can be colored differently or deleted. The characters must be English lower case letters and no spaces or characters should be used exept for '_'. Mirror Painting: Automatically copy all edits to the opposite side of the model according to the X axis. Entity Modeling and Animation | Microsoft Learn To avoid stretched or invisible faces, make sure the size of cubes sticks to full numbers. In a 3D space there are three axes: X, Y and Z. Press Z to switch between Textured, Solid and Wireframe Mode. How to apply textures and animations to a model. You can also use this tool on cubes if you want to rotate those around a specific point. And use the same name as your file name for your model. Here, we'll just use the Blockbench Paint tab and select colors . The HSV Color Picker, aside from the hue ribbon and saturation/value coordinate system, contains the HSV sliders and two actions - Add To Palette and Pick Screen Color. This will automatically generate a new keyframe. I made about 24 custom block models in Blockbench and imported them to Mcreator. These animations can be a good starting point for vanilla-like entities, but of course, custom animations are a lot more powerful. Features include: - Concurrent animation support. [TUTORIAL] How you can hide hunger or any other bar! This name will be used both for the generated file, as well as for the name in the pack menu in Minecraft. Is there anyway around this? In a 3D space there are three axes: X, Y and Z. The controller is linked in the animations section and played in scripts. Activating the behavior pack will also automatically activate the connected resource pack. If you want to focus your attention only on the model itself, press the little arrow icons (in the right and left corner of the Status Bar) to toggle the Sidebars. For more information, please see our File name, texture name, and model identifier name must be the same. This Website will guide you to the correct Blockbench format for your model as well as important information, tutorials and resources! The Time Ruler is the strip (at the top of the Main View) that graphically represents time using equally spaced markings (units of time). We can leave the field for the file name empty for now as we'll later define it when we export the model. Custom entity behavior is a huge topic, and this article won't attempt to touch on it. It will just fade out once the value is false/0 again, and the next time it will fade into the animation again. Select the workspace from the new tab option under the "Minecraft" category you will find the list of workspaces here. You can also close the dialog and select Keep to keep your current state and inputs. Spaces and other special characters aren't supported. That's why it's important that the head of the model uses the exact same name. To quickly enable this, you can use the following steps. Click on one of its vertices that needs to be snapped. For simple animations that are always active while the entity exists, this is as simple as listing the short name in the scripts/animate array in the client entity file. You can paint directly on the model in 3D space, use the 2D texture editor, or connect your favorite external image editor . I solved the problem. A good practice is to use a root bone for each model and put everything else inside it. Customize Blockbench with the built-in plugin store. The names above must not be the same as any other modded entities in your mod's namespace. If you want to create a straight line, click on the beginning of the line, then hold shift on the end of the line. The current version supports forward kinematic animations designed in blockbench. Links. its coordinates are (0, 0, 0). For example, if you want to create a shark, you can choose the dolphin preset. Now we need to link the animation controller to our entity. The sidebars contain different panels (e.g. We will be showing you how to make custom models and u. If you cannot find the specific file format you need, we will convert the available format for you. When scrubbing through the Timeline, the Playhead snaps to valid frame times by default. Press J to jump to the feed. Quickstart. .c4d, .dae, .fbx, .max, .obj, .3ds, .blend, .wrl, .mb, .lwo, .dxf. Paint Bucket: Fill (depending on the Fill Mode) faces, cubes or connected or separate areas of the texture with a single color. This is done in the animations section in the description tag of the entity. Privacy Policy. Plugins extend the functionality of Blockbench beyond what it's already capable of. This download is safe, so don't worry :) Open the Launcher exe and start it. The Rotate feature enables you to turn the selected elements by 90 in either direction on any axis. In this video I will be showing you guys how to use Blockbench for making living entities in Mcreator. Now you can go over your cubes and color them in individual base colors.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. I'm trying to make an entity, but I can't figure out how to use the Pivot Tool. How to use Blockbench for Mods in Mcreator!!SUPER EASY! Open an issue to report bugs within plugins and tag the author if possible. It is recommended for beginners to use the behavior from the same mob as the appearance, to avoid conflicts. Each time the entity is loaded by the client, for example, when joining a world, the animation controller starts in an initial state. You can upload an image as an icon to represent your pack in the pack menu. We have Royalty free blockbench 3D Models. I have tried to import JSON 3d models into mcreator and it doesn't work? Models in Minecraft use a specific format that uses JSON to define the shape. A pivot point is the center of rotation of a bone. There are also stripped down "basic" presets that you can use if you are a more experienced add-on creator and want to create entity behavior from scratch. It will hide potentially sensitive information like unreleased projects. But, depending on the length of your animation, you might notice that if the robot loses the ground two times with a short interval, the second time it won't play the animation. Use cuboids to get that Minecraft aesthetic, or create complex low-poly shapes using the mesh modeling tools! The animation controller will always start in this state when the entity is loaded. Mcreator Tutorial: Custom Tool Model [BlockBench] - YouTube The coordinates get higher in the + direction (from the origin to where the arrow points) of each axis and lower in the - direction (from the origin to away from where the arrow points) of each axis. I drawer the texture in the "blokbench" but in the game is still pink-black texture (My texture there is none in the vanila minecraft). Once the shape of the model is done, you can create a texture template. In the Per-Face UV mode, there is a different tab for each face's UV in the UV Editor. Elements can be selected in the Viewport and Outliner by left-clicking. That means that the texture mapping will only use full numbers and will round down to a smaller number if necessary. The Inflate slider can be found next to the Size sliders in the Element panel. The cube is snapped into the correct position. You can learn how to model and animate in this tutorial playlist: ArtsByKev Blockbench Tutorials. Enter the world and follow the instructions in the wizard to spawn your custom entity. It comes with a set of default tools dependent on the interface mode, but can be customized, like all the other toolbars. Click confirm. If Minecraft is open when import has started you will need to relaunch it. If wrong, change the texture order. Help with MCreator Software and Bugs and solutions are two forums with many solved questions (perhaps your question already has an answer there). Make sure to use the correct one in order to avoid your models standing out from the rest of the inventory. Hey there! Please contact the moderators of this subreddit if you have any questions or concerns. The Blockbench Wiki has step by step guides and reference documentation for modeling, texturing, and animating any custom creation you can imagine. How can I resolve this issue? As an example, if you mix the appearance of a wolf with the behavior of a sheep (a sheep in wolf's clothing), you will quickly notice that the wolf in Minecraft does not come with a grazing animation, so it will look like the grass below them just pops off. Hold Shift to draw a line with the Paint Brush or Eraser. Holding Alt temporarily selects the color picker for the duration of holding Alt (and switches back after you stop holding Alt). In per-face UV mapping, the mapping of the faces stays intact after performing the rotate action. You can learn how to set up Visual Studio Code for addon development under this link. A trick to add cubes faster is to select an already positioned cube and press Ctrl + D (duplicate) to get a copy. cube, locator, etc. Only one of these states is active at a time. Minecraft is a registered trademark of Mojang. ; The Wizard. For regular pixel art textures, you can directly use Blockbench's pixel art tools without the need for external software. Reddit and its partners use cookies and similar technologies to provide you with a better experience. ), Cube: element of the geometry (refers to all cuboids regardless of dimensions, not just geometric cubes), Plane: special type of cube with only 2 faces (due to one of the dimensions of the cube being 0), Locator: dimensionless element in the model that can be used as a reference point (e.g. Each state can play a distinct set of animations, sounds, and particle effects. You can organize your timeline by color-coding keyframes. You can report bug reports and feature requests through our own support system. [NEW TUTORIAL] Custom Entity Animations and Resizing Models #20 - GitHub I putthe texture in the "blockbench" but in the game is still pink-black texture (My texture there is none in the vanila minecraft). Depending on the export option you have selected, you may need to enter some information about the Add-On that the wizard is about to create. and did you assign textures to the models? The origin of the coordinate system is the point of intersection between the three axes, i.e. Its relatively small (only about a slab and a half high) but its hitbox is the same as the player's. The important part is Mob Geometry Name. You can paint directly on the model in 3D space, use the 2D texture editor, or connect your favorite external image editor or pixel art software. If you stream Blockbench, but don't want your audience to see other projects you worked on, enable Streamer Mode in the Settings ("File" > "Preferences" > "Settings" > "General"). Sketchfab is a platform to publish, share, discover, buy and sell 3D, VR and AR content. Open the Preview menu (right click in the Viewport or click the 3 dots in the top right corner of the Viewport) to load and edit background images. Regarding the resizing vanilla entity models. "Copy" and "Paste" actions allow you to transfer the values from one Slot to another. Select a keyframe (or a group of keyframes) and right click to choose a marker color. Once the plugin is installed, you can use the Minecraft Entity Wizard to start . We've also linked an existing animation to the model and created our own animation in Blockbench. By default the spacing equals 1 pixel unit (16 units in a meter), but it can be adjusted in "Settings" > "Snapping" > "Grid Resolution". Once on Sketchfab, you can change lighting and effects and create renders or share your model. Create or import palettes, paint, or draw shapes. MCreator/Blockbench not working? But now we'll only play the sway animation under the condition that the robot isn't on ground. Theres a small thing with textures. A line will appear between the two vertices on hover. To create the model and texture, we're going to use Blockbench, a 3D modeling program that can create models for the Bedrock Edition of Minecraft. The template is a texture that has a unique space for every cube and every face of the model. Just click on the eye icon in the outliner. Now that the behavior is set up, we'll head to the client entity file. approved by or associated with Mojang. The Display Name is the name that the entity will later be called in Minecraft. For example, the Thirdperson and Head slots offer displaying the model on the player, zombie, baby zombie, armor stand and small armor stand. Once you have done that you should have a UV map like below but with the amount of cubes you have in your model. Ultimately, which solution is best depends on the use case. You can also choose a longer name or include a namespace to ensure compatibility with other addons. Move your time cursor in the timeline to 0 seconds and click the plus icon next to Rotation. Once you have created your basic entity in the Entity Wizard, you can continue to use Blockbench to modify the model, and you can edit the behavior in an external program (more on that later). You can also build your portfolio or embed models into your website. to other players or when switching views using F5), Firstperson (left and right): what the handheld model looks like to the player holding it, while in first-person view, Ground: when dropped on the ground (floating above the ground), GUI: in the GUI (graphical user interface; e.g. Create a new group in Blockbench. On the far left, below the Timecode, there is a list of all bones and their channels. Select the cube you are trying to move (or scale). Below it, there are three tabs: Picker (which shows the HSV color picker), Palette (which shows the palette with options to import, export, generate, sort and load a palette) and Both (which shows both the HSV color picker and the palette at the same time). Instead, here are some helpful resources to help you get started: To view all of the available behaviors, properties, and AI Goals that an entity can use, you can go to the Entity JSON Reference Documentation. The Scrollbar at the bottom of the panel lets you pan the Main View. Side light is intended for models shown at an angle (like blocks in vanilla Minecraft). Same for creating models.. Blockbench is provided by external, third-party contributors and is not a Mojang/Microsoft offering. It is not In the example above you have three control sections first being "presets" that controls the copy and pasting as well as making custom presets or using existing ones you have made or the default game presets. In this tutorial, you will learn the following: It's recommended that the following be completed before beginning this tutorial. You can move cubes more precisely by holding either shift, control, or both at the same time. But when i load the game and try to mine them I get stutters and fps drops but only if I break them. You can also UV map cubes manually, but creating a template does the work for you and finds the most space-efficient layout. More info about Internet Explorer and Microsoft Edge, How to create a model for an entity using. The Main Toolbar in Edit Mode offers the following tools by default: Pressing Space or double-clicking switches between the alternative tools (Move and Resize; Rotate and Pivot Tool). Make sure that the format version for this file is set to 1.10.0 or higher for this to work. comment down below what tutorials I should do next ---. It won't play from the start again. MCreator software and website are developed and maintained by Pylo. I don't think this is possible either, you can create models or use a addon in Blockbench to create the model then rescale the meshes, however this would also require you to adjust the position as they don't scale up really well as the position stays the same. The workspace you will need to use will vary depending on the model type. Usually, you can do this by getting a spawn egg from the creative inventory and using it. Minecraft is a registered trademark of Mojang. This tool allows you to move the pivot point of the bone. Outliner, UV Panel) depending on the interface mode (Edit, Paint, Animate, Display). Now that you know how to animate, you can refine the animation and, for example, let the antenna swing a bit. An animation controller can have an unlimited number of states. I had some issues with the rotation of the wings i. The name for a bone should be snake_case (so only including lower case letters, numbers, and underscores). MCreator software and website are developed and maintained by Pylo. The UV Panel consists of the UV Editor, texture size, Full View (a dialog pops up with a larger version of the UV Editor) and UV Window buttons (a dialog pops up that displays all faces next to each other). By donating to developers you can speed up development, as with more resources, we can dedicate more time to MCreator. File has stuff like Project naming, new model, saving and more. and our Lock Alpha Channel: Disable painting on transparent parts of the texture. We can use the query query.all_animations_finished to only transition after the animation has played. The pack icon is optional. Create, edit and paint texture right inside the program. You can install Blockbench as a Progressive Web App. "Groups" and "Bones" are essentially the same in this context. To do this reliably, use the Center feature for the axis where you wish to center your model. its coordinates are (0, 0, 0). Copyright 2023 Pylo Ltd. - All Rights Reserved. The color picker also works on background images. -Links-StrawS Mcreator armor tutorial for reference on the pivot pointshttps://mcreator.net/forum/51185/tutorial-how-make-3d-rendered-armor-moving-arms-legs-and-head-Links to help you get started-https://mcreator.net/https://www.blockbench.net/https://www.audacityteam.org/https://notepad-plus-plus.org/https://www.minecraftforum.net/forums/mapping-and-modding-java-edition/minecraft-modshttps://www.youtube.com/c/NorthWestTrees---Minecraft Mods - Friends of ChewyB---Wastelands of Baedoor by Toma400https://mcreator.net/modification/72019/wastelands-baedoorShattered World Limits _SK_https://mcreator.net/modification/81975/new-world-height-and-depth---ChewyB Mods---https://www.curseforge.com/members/chewybullets/projects 00:00 - Setting up the texture pattern and pivot point summery.02:08 - Creating a helmet.17:37 - Importing to MCreator20:33 - Testing helmet and shooting a deer.#mcreator #minecraft #blockbench